[–]spawnch[S] 1 point2 points  (0 children)

2 aputure storm 1000cs with fresnels bounced off of mirrors mounted as high as they can in the space, double nets in front of the lights to cut shine a bit with flags around the lights to get rid of spill in the hallway as much as i can

lighting tests for upcoming short film by spawnch in cinematography

[–]spawnch[S] 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Just finished my second lighting test for an upcoming short film i’m DPing. It is shot in a studio with not a lot of space so it’s been a struggle getting “realistic” moonlight when the lights have to be so close to the window. I want a stylistic moonlight similar to what is shown here and am really happy with the results so far!!! I’m looking for any criticism or tips to improve it as I still have a few weeks before we go to camera.

[–]spawnch 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Student film I shot earlier this year. It was a challenge shooting outside in a car. Limiting the space and only being able to light with battery powered lights were the biggest ones. For the dialogue scenes we actually did rear projection in a controlled location with powered lights and I was pretty happy with the way it turned out. I’m looking for feedback on ways to light a car scene better, this was a first attempt and I was going for a more stylized 80s vibe but i’d love to have done it more naturalistic.
